Wilhelm Kempff has come in for a huge amount of criticism elsewhere on the 'net, mostly for technical limitations. (It's remarkable to see how consensuses differ from list to list, even when devoted to the same topic.) His recording of Brahms' Opp. 116-119 is fine, but has worn a little for me over time, and is a bit harsh-sounding in sections. He doesn't plumb the depths of Op. 119 as deeply as Radu Lupu, for one example. - seb
